@@ -0,0 +1,393 @@
|
||||
"""
|
||||
Gmail Tools - Gmail integration via Composio.
|
||||
|
||||
Provides tools for Gmail operations like sending, reading, and searching emails.
|
||||
Requires COMPOSIO_API_KEY environment variable.
|
||||
"""
|
||||
from __future__ import annotations
|
||||
|
||||
import os
|
||||
from typing import TYPE_CHECKING, Any, Optional, Tuple
|
||||
|
||||
from fastmcp import FastMCP
|
||||
|
||||
if TYPE_CHECKING:
|
||||
from aden_tools.credentials import CredentialManager
|
||||
|
||||
# App name for Composio
|
||||
GMAIL_APP_NAME = "GMAIL"
|
||||
|
||||
|
||||
def _get_composio_client(credentials: Optional["CredentialManager"] = None):
|
||||
"""Get Composio client with API key from credentials or environment."""
|
||||
try:
|
||||
from composio import ComposioToolSet
|
||||
except ImportError:
|
||||
return None, "Composio SDK not installed. Run: pip install composio-core"
|
||||
|
||||
if credentials is not None:
|
||||
api_key = credentials.get("composio")
|
||||
else:
|
||||
api_key = os.getenv("COMPOSIO_API_KEY")
|
||||
|
||||
if not api_key:
|
||||
return None, "COMPOSIO_API_KEY not set. Get one at https://app.composio.dev/settings"
|
||||
|
||||
return ComposioToolSet(api_key=api_key), None
|
||||
|
||||
|
||||
def _check_oauth_connection(
|
||||
client: Any,
|
||||
app_name: str = GMAIL_APP_NAME,
|
||||
entity_id: str = "default",
|
||||
) -> Tuple[bool, Optional[str], Optional[str]]:
|
||||
"""
|
||||
Check if OAuth connection exists for the given app.
|
||||
|
||||
Args:
|
||||
client: ComposioToolSet instance
|
||||
app_name: The app to check connection for (e.g., "GMAIL")
|
||||
entity_id: The entity ID (defaults to "default")
|
||||
|
||||
Returns:
|
||||
Tuple of (is_connected, oauth_url, error_message)
|
||||
- If connected: (True, None, None)
|
||||
- If not connected: (False, oauth_url, None)
|
||||
- If error: (False, None, error_message)
|
||||
"""
|
||||
try:
|
||||
# Get the entity
|
||||
entity = client.get_entity(id=entity_id)
|
||||
|
||||
# Check for existing connection using correct API method
|
||||
try:
|
||||
# Use get_connection(app=...) - the correct Composio API
|
||||
connection = entity.get_connection(app=app_name)
|
||||
if connection:
|
||||
status = getattr(connection, "status", None)
|
||||
if status == "ACTIVE" or status is None:
|
||||
return True, None, None
|
||||
except Exception:
|
||||
# No connection found, need to initiate OAuth
|
||||
pass
|
||||
|
||||
# No active connection, initiate OAuth
|
||||
try:
|
||||
connection_request = entity.initiate_connection(
|
||||
app_name=app_name,
|
||||
redirect_url="https://app.composio.dev/connections",
|
||||
)
|
||||
oauth_url = getattr(connection_request, "redirectUrl", None)
|
||||
if oauth_url:
|
||||
return False, oauth_url, None
|
||||
else:
|
||||
# Fallback to Composio dashboard
|
||||
return False, f"https://app.composio.dev/app/{app_name.lower()}", None
|
||||
except Exception as e:
|
||||
# If initiate_connection fails, provide dashboard link
|
||||
return False, f"https://app.composio.dev/app/{app_name.lower()}", None
|
||||
|
||||
except Exception as e:
|
||||
return False, None, f"Failed to check OAuth connection: {str(e)}"
|
||||
|
||||
|
||||
def _ensure_oauth_connection(
|
||||
credentials: Optional["CredentialManager"] = None,
|
||||
app_name: str = GMAIL_APP_NAME,
|
||||
) -> Tuple[Any, Optional[dict]]:
|
||||
"""
|
||||
Ensure OAuth connection exists, return client or OAuth required response.
|
||||
|
||||
Args:
|
||||
credentials: Optional CredentialManager
|
||||
app_name: The app to check connection for
|
||||
|
||||
Returns:
|
||||
Tuple of (client, error_response)
|
||||
- If connected: (client, None)
|
||||
- If OAuth needed: (None, {"error": ..., "oauth_required": True, "oauth_url": ...})
|
||||
- If other error: (None, {"error": ...})
|
||||
"""
|
||||
client, error = _get_composio_client(credentials)
|
||||
if error:
|
||||
return None, {"error": error}
|
||||
|
||||
is_connected, oauth_url, check_error = _check_oauth_connection(client, app_name)
|
||||
|
||||
if check_error:
|
||||
return None, {"error": check_error}
|
||||
|
||||
if not is_connected:
|
||||
return None, {
|
||||
"error": f"{app_name} OAuth connection required. Please authorize access.",
|
||||
"oauth_required": True,
|
||||
"oauth_url": oauth_url,
|
||||
"message": f"Please visit the following URL to connect your {app_name} account: {oauth_url}",
|
||||
}
|
||||
|
||||
return client, None
|
||||
|
||||
|
||||
def register_tools(
|
||||
mcp: FastMCP,
|
||||
credentials: Optional["CredentialManager"] = None,
|
||||
) -> None:
|
||||
"""Register Gmail tools with the MCP server."""
|
||||
|
||||
@mcp.tool()
|
||||
def gmail_send_email(
|
||||
to: str,
|
||||
subject: str,
|
||||
body: str,
|
||||
cc: str = "",
|
||||
bcc: str = "",
|
||||
) -> dict:
|
||||
"""
|
||||
Send an email via Gmail.
|
||||
|
||||
Use this to compose and send an email from the user's Gmail account.
|
||||
|
||||
Args:
|
||||
to: Recipient email address(es), comma-separated for multiple
|
||||
subject: Email subject line
|
||||
body: Email body content (plain text or HTML)
|
||||
cc: CC recipients, comma-separated (optional)
|
||||
bcc: BCC recipients, comma-separated (optional)
|
||||
|
||||
Returns:
|
||||
Dict with message ID and status, or error dict
|
||||
"""
|
||||
if not to:
|
||||
return {"error": "Recipient email address is required"}
|
||||
|
||||
if not subject:
|
||||
return {"error": "Email subject is required"}
|
||||
|
||||
if not body:
|
||||
return {"error": "Email body is required"}
|
||||
|
||||
client, error_response = _ensure_oauth_connection(credentials, GMAIL_APP_NAME)
|
||||
if error_response:
|
||||
return error_response
|
||||
|
||||
try:
|
||||
from composio import Action
|
||||
|
||||
params = {
|
||||
"to": to,
|
||||
"subject": subject,
|
||||
"body": body,
|
||||
}
|
||||
if cc:
|
||||
params["cc"] = cc
|
||||
if bcc:
|
||||
params["bcc"] = bcc
|
||||
|
||||
result = client.execute_action(
|
||||
action=Action.GMAIL_SEND_EMAIL,
|
||||
params=params,
|
||||
)
|
||||
|
||||
if result.get("successful"):
|
||||
return {
|
||||
"success": True,
|
||||
"message_id": result.get("data", {}).get("id"),
|
||||
"thread_id": result.get("data", {}).get("threadId"),
|
||||
"message": "Email sent successfully",
|
||||
}
|
||||
else:
|
||||
return {"error": result.get("error", "Failed to send email")}
|
||||
|
||||
except Exception as e:
|
||||
return {"error": f"Gmail send failed: {str(e)}"}
